The first team I’m going to do is my favorite team, Everton. Everton began their history as St Domingo’s FC. They did moderately at the time, but later they changed their name. The first game after a name change to Everton Football Club took place at Stanley Park against St Peter’s. Everton won 6-0 on December 20, 1879. Later Everton won its first cup trophy. Winning the Liverpool cup and destroyed the competition. Then on October 15, 1887, Everton played their first game in the F.A. Cup. They lost 1-0 to the Bolton Wanderers. Soon they became one of the founders of the now Skybet League 1 in England. The story of how they became one of the 12 founder clubs of the Football League 1 is here if you want to know more about it. March 15, 1892, is when they left the old home stadium, Anfield, where their current rivals, Liverpool FC, plays. They then moved to Goodison Park Field where they still play today. The first game they ever played against Liverpool FC was in the Merseyside derby on October 13, 1894, with a record crowd of 44,000. They won 3-0 against their rivals.
